Corelation of Various Causes of Neonatal Seizures With Different Patterns of EEG Waveforms

摘要
Introduction: Electroencephalography, or EEG for short, is a non-invasive way to monitor brain activities. It is much helpful in seizures detection and quantification and for assessment of cortical activity. 3 In our study we aimed to correlate various causes of neonatal seizures with different patterns of EEG waveforms. Material and methods : the study was conducted in a tertiary care hospital in central India. 120 Full term neonates with clinical seizures were included in the study and an EEG analysis was done for these children. Results: clonic seizures(40%) were the most common type of seizures and birth asphyxia (70%)was the most common aetiology of clinical neonatal seizures. Metabolic causes (hypoglycaemia 71.4%and hypocalcaemia 74%) produced more number of normal , whereas birth asphyxia and meningitis(66.7% each) produced more number of abnormal waveforms on EEG. Conclusion : birth asphyxia and meningitis produce more number of abnormal waveforms on EEG in comparision to metabolic causes of neonatal seizures
